When it came to the India-Pakistan clash during Game 2 of the Asia Cup T20 2022 at the Dubai International Stadium on Sunday, it was nervy and went down to the wire. As the Men in Blue needed seven off the final six deliveries, pressure revolved around both sides. Also, a wicket off the first ball of the over instantly put pressure on the Indians. Nevertheless, all-rounder Hardik Pandya kept calm and ensured that he hammered one enormous shot of orthodox spinner Mohammad Nawaz to get the job done with just a couple of balls to spare. Consequently, India had its payback from last year's ICC T20 World Cup defeat to the side at this venue.
